Soldier killed in NPA Clash in Malibcong, Abra

Soldier killed in clash between military and NPA rebels in Malibcong, Abra.

The military is continuing its pursuit operations against those who encountered its troops believed to be a group of New People's Army rebels under the Komiteng Larangang Gerilya North Abra in the neighborhood of Barangay Pacqued, Malibcong, Abra.

In an interview, Major Rogelio Dumbrique Jr., Civil Military Operations Officer of the 7th Infantry Division, Philippine Army said the encounter resulted in the death of 2LT ZALDY V LAPIS from Iloilo City.

He said the soldiers received a series of information from concerned citizens of Barangay Pacqued about the armed group who regularly go to their barangay to recruit and carry out extortion.

As a result, the 24th Infantry Battalion and 72nd Division Reconnaissance Company responded with a security patrol in the mountains of the said barangay to verify the reports.

However, here they have already encountered about 15 NPA members where the encounter lasted for about one and a half hours.

The military, on the other hand, thanked the people of Abra for providing information on the illegal activities of the rebels in their area, showing that the AbreƱos do not agree with the presence of communist rebels in their province.

Meanwhile, Major General Alfredo V. Rosario Jr. PA, Commander of the 7th Infantry Division, Philippine Army, led the Departure Honors for the late 2LT ZALDY V LAPIS whose remains on board SN 212I aircraft of the Philippine Air Force will be flown to his hometown in Dingle, Ilo-ilo province where he will soon be laid to rest.
